Allu Arjun starrer Pushpa, which has been making a lot of buzz for the last few weeks, is finally releasing this Friday in theatres. Fans of the superstar are all excited to watch the film in cinema but the film is making headlines for the wrong reason.

#BoycottPushpaInKarnataka is currently trending on Twitter. Several netizens are slamming the makers of the action thriller for giving their first preference to the film’s original language rather than the state’s. Scroll down to know more.

Reportedly, the Kannada version of Allu Arjun’s Pushpa only has three shows in Bengaluru and this did not go down well with the Kannada moviegoers. Moreover, no Kannada shows will be screened on Friday due to a censor issue but its Telugu version is released in major centers of the state. This has irked many Kannadigas.
